Understanding the Specialist's Duty
When you think of youngster psychiatric therapy, it's essential to comprehend the specialist's role while doing so. The specialist serves as a guide, helping your youngster navigate their ideas and feelings in a safe atmosphere.
They develop a relying on connection, making it much easier for your kid to express themselves openly. By utilizing play, art, and conversation, the therapist motivates your kid to discover their emotions and create coping techniques.
This strategy permits the specialist to comprehend your kid's one-of-a-kind viewpoint and challenges. Your involvement as a parent is also vital; the therapist might provide insights to assist you sustain your youngster's trip.
Ultimately, the therapist's role is to encourage your kid, promoting psychological growth and durability throughout the therapeutic procedure.
What to Anticipate Throughout the Session
As you get in the therapy room with your child, you could notice a warm and inviting ambience made to make them really feel comfortable.
The specialist will likely greet both of you warmly, intending to establish a link.
During the session, your child might begin with play or drawing, which helps them share their feelings naturally.
You'll possibly sit close by, allowing your youngster to engage openly while the specialist observes and engages delicately.
Expect a concentrate on building depend on and relationship as opposed to diving deep right into problems right now.
The session may last regarding 45 to 60 minutes, providing your kid area to discover their ideas and feelings in a secure environment.
Common Questions Parents Could Be Asked
What kind of information might your youngster's specialist want from you? Anticipate questions concerning your youngster's actions in your home and college, their relationships with peers and household, and any kind of significant life adjustments they have actually experienced.
The specialist may ask about your kid's mood, such as mood swings, anxiousness, or anxiety. They'll likely inquire about your family dynamics and any psychological health concerns that run in the household.
It's likewise usual for them to inquire about your child's passions, strengths, and challenges, along with your expectations for treatment.
Being open and honest assists produce a supportive atmosphere, enabling the specialist to comprehend your child far better and customize their approach effectively. Your understandings are essential in this procedure.
